Denied application
Hi all,
I am writing this post here from Taoyuan airport's terminal two. I am a NEXUS member and my friend is a global entry member, and am trying to enroll in the e-gates using the enrollment center next to aisle 20. The wait was 15 minutes. When it was our turn, we were denied because we did not have a residence permit. The staffs were not aware of the Global Entry program. Then i checked the website... and apparently you need to set up an interview. https://egate.immigration.gov.tw/ge-frontend/home Don't go to the counter without applying in the above website. Just go online and wait till the above website accepts new registration. Carfield |

Originally Posted by hayzel7773
(Post 29023193)
Taiwan foreign policy is one of reciprocity. Since the US charges Taiwanese $100USD+Interview+Online App for Global Entry, Taiwan implemented the same policy for GE holders applying for Egate(albeit you pay NT$3000, which is roughly 100USD)
